People in Greenville search for an “AI talcum powder attorney” because they want fast clarity—especially when they’re facing chemotherapy, follow-ups, and accumulating medical bills.
AI-guided tools can be useful for:
- Building a timeline of product use and symptom progression
- Listing documents you may need (pathology reports, imaging, treatment summaries)
- Drafting questions to ask your doctor or to request records
- Organizing facts so you don’t have to rely on memory alone
But AI tools cannot:
- Confirm medical causation
- Replace a lawyer’s evaluation of legal theories and Ohio-specific procedural needs
- Negotiate with insurers or defendants
- Review the fine details that determine whether evidence is strong or missing
Think of AI as a starting point for structure—not the final decision-maker.
